DUMP TRAILER Electrical power UNIT- SINGLE ACTING
Common Description
This energy unit features a power up gravity down circuit. Get started the motor to lengthen the cylinder and activate the solenoid valve to retract the circuit. Manual override to solenoid valve is usually presented if needed. Also a pressure compen sated movement control might be additional to the circuit to control the descent pace of the cylinder.

Special Notes
one. This power unit is of S3 duty cycle, i.e., non-continuous operation, thirty seconds on and 270 seconds off.
2. Clean all the hydraulic components concerned prior to installation of the energy unit.
three. Viscosity of the hydraulic oil shoud be 15~46 cst,which ought to also be clean and totally free of impurities.N46 hydraulic oil is advisable.
four. The electrical power unit needs to be mounted horizontally.
5. Check the oil level within the tank soon after the first operating of the power unit.
6. Oil changing is required immediately after the original 100 operation hours, afterwards the moment just about every 3000 hours.
